Back in Ohio this week and of all the wonderful food to be thankful for today, mashed potatoes and turkey are behind the return of Dan Dee’s Cheddar Cheese Flavored Corn Twistees. They ran regionally (Midwest) from 1928-2018 and I ate approximately 614 tons of the stuff as a kid. Not only did they return this year, but they appear to have a copy cat using even the same clip art. Although I like Pirate’s Booty, there really is nothing else like them. You can tell from these online reviews. 

"Dan Dee products have been part of my upbringing in Cleveland forever. They also taste superior. I am deeply disappointed to lose this cultural treasure. "The end of a Cleveland legend.”

"These were the snack foods you found in ancient vending machines in decrepit auto shops when your car broke down in the middle of nowheresville. You ate maybe two before realizing you'd get more flavor from the dirt on the floor."

Warning: Orange.
